The Master of Science in Management - Homeland Security program at Colorado Technical University is designed to combine organizational research and analysis skills with an understanding of the assortment of threats against national security. Offered online and on-campus, Colorado Technical University's Master of Science in Management - Homeland Security program explores quantitative, qualitative, mixed, and action-based research methods as well as the analysis and application of data and statistics in managerial decision-making. Homeland security coursework examines the dynamics of terrorism, the role of the media, the psychological effects of terrorism on the public, and fear management. You will have the opportunity to learn about the use of technology to prevent, respond to, and recover from terrorist attacks and natural disasters; policy and organizational issues in the U.S. intelligence community; vulnerability analysis and the protection of critical infrastructures; and the difference between public perceptions and homeland security professionals' perceptions of homeland security, and how those differences both limit and influence certain elements of homeland security.

The Master of Science in Management - Homeland Security program consists of 16 core credits and 28 concentration credits, for a total of 44 required credits. The online program may have slightly different coursework than the campus-based program, and will require specific computer and software access.
Management Course Requirements
Course Code | Course Name |
---|---|
EMBA 690 | Strategic Management in Dynamic Environments |
INTD 670 | Leadership and Ethical Decision-Making |
MGMT 600 | Applied Managerial Decision-Making |
MGMT 605 | Graduate Research Methods |
Homeland Security Course Requirements
Course Code | Course Name |
---|---|
HLS 600 | Homeland Security Fundamentals |
HLS 610 | Dynamics of Terrorism |
HLS 620 | Technology Solutions for HLS |
HLS 630 | Organizational and Policy Challenges |
HLS 640 | Vulnerability Analysis and Protection |
HLS 650 | Homeland Security and Government |
HLS 660 | Psychology of Fear Management |
